Fresh Food Artistry at the Boatshed

We went for a run on the beach this morning and then went to the Boatshed Market in Cottesloe to buy some fruit and vegetables.  The standard of produce at this place is always reliable and high quality - and there is a passion for food and good service.

This morning we were struck by the quality of the display.  It was amazing.  All the vegetable items arranged so carefully - aligned, balanced, poised.

Even the brussell sprouts were arranged so that they all faced the same way in their stack.

The vegetables were bursting with vitality and energy and screaming "buy me - I'm good for you".

I snapped an iPhone photo of part of the display.


Then we had to find out who the Fresh Food Artist was.  We asked Trevor (who explained he was the tropical fruit guy) and he said the vegetable displays were done by Robert Stedman - who restocks the shelves each night starting at 10 pm.
